Tank vent breathers offer protection

Published: 5-Oct-2007

Brownell has extended its range of tank vent breathers and adsorbers.


The latest range prevents the contamination of valuable fluids from harmful moisture condensation in many process applications, while at the same time, eliminating the release of toxic vapours from the tank into the atmosphere.

Installation of these breathers has been made quick and simply, with a direct connection to an existing breather or vent pipe immediately removing the water vapour entering the tank.

A removable adsorbent container allows the unit’s desiccant material to be changed without breaking the breather pipe connection.

A distinctive change in the desiccant’s colour signals when it is saturated and needs to be replaced or reactivated.

Fluid properties adversely affected by humidity and moisture vapour adsorbtion include viscosity, electrical insulation and chemical stability. High adsorbed water levels can also lead to fluids freezing at low temperatures.
